What is an allergy?
Allergies can be defined as abnormal reactions of the immune system in response to otherwise harmless substances. Allergies are probably the most common of medical disorders, it is estimated that 60 million Americans suffer from some sort of allergy. An allergy is a type of immune reaction to a normally harmless substance, the substance is commonly known as an allergen, and most commonly can include pollens, dust particles, mold spores, food, household pets, latex rubber, insect venom, or medicines. Scientists believe that people inherit a tendency to be allergic, but not to any specific allergen. Exposure to allergens at times when the body's defenses are weakened, such as after a viral infection or during pregnancy, can contribute to the development of allergies. Some people with allergies can develop asthma, symptoms include coughing, wheezing, and shortness of breath due to a narrowing of the bronchial passages in the lungs, or due to excess mucous production and inflammation.
Symptoms of allergies often include a runny nose, sinus congestion, sneezing, etc., which are common with symptoms of a common cold, but if the symptoms are longer lasting than normal, for example more than a week or two, medical attention should be sought. Doctors can use skin tests and blood tests to determine allergies and offer diagnostic advice, including avoidance (for example don't eat a specific food), innoculations, and medications.
